Not only are ADUs smaller sized and as a result more budget-friendly to construct; frequently, they can likewise be constructed in existing spaces like a garage or cellar. They additionally get rid of the demand to spend for extra land. And also, owners do not require to set up energy infrastructure, considering that it's already in position and likely simply needs to be expanded from the major residence.

A garage conversion turns a pre-existing structure right into a full-blown living room. This includes equipping it with home heating and air conditioning, insulation, as well as adding water for a washroom and kitchen. A comparable idea to a garage conversion is a carriage house loft, frequently built within a bigger garage with high ceilings.

Energy-efficient Adu Near Me Walnut Creek CA

An internal conversion option is to produce a cellar apartment (such as an in-law collection). Basement apartment or condos include an outside entry separate from that for the major home (though in some cases you have to go through the yard to accessibility it). Depending upon the homeowner's planned use, there might or may not need to be an entry to the main home from inside the home.
